### Pros and Cons of Buying a GM 7818191 (1968 1976 Chevy C10) Power Steering Gear Box with Pitman Arm (4x2, 2WD)

---

#### **Pros**

1. **Compatibility and Fitment**

The GM 7818191 power steering gearbox and pitman arm are designed specifically for the 1968 1976 Chevrolet C10 pickup trucks, ensuring a direct fit without major modifications. This reduces the risk of installation issues and ensures proper alignment and function.

2. **Reliability and Durability**

As a factory or high-quality aftermarket replacement part, this gearbox and pitman arm are built to withstand the demands of daily driving in a 2WD C10. The components are designed to last for years with proper maintenance, making them a cost-effective solution for restoring or maintaining steering functionality.

3. **Ease of Installation**

Since these parts are designed for the C10 platform, they are relatively straightforward to install, especially if you have basic mechanical skills or access to a mechanic familiar with Chevy trucks from this era. The pitman arm connects directly to the steering linkage, and the gearbox mounts securely to the frame, requiring minimal adjustments.

4. **Cost-Effective Replacement**

Compared to rebuilding or replacing an entire steering system, purchasing a new or refurbished gearbox and pitman arm is a budget-friendly option. It avoids the labor-intensive process of disassembling and reassembling a damaged gearbox, which can be costly if done professionally.

5. **Availability of Parts and Support**

GM parts from this era, especially those with a specific part number like 7818191, are still widely available through auto parts retailers, salvage yards, or online marketplaces. This makes it easier to source additional components (e.g., tie rods, idler arms) if needed during installation or later maintenance.

6. **Preservation of Original Functionality**

If your C10 s original gearbox or pitman arm is worn out or damaged, replacing them with a new unit restores the truck s intended steering performance. This is particularly important for maintaining the truck s handling characteristics, which are critical for both safety and driving enjoyment.

7. **Compatibility with Aftermarket Upgrades**

The 7818191 gearbox and pitman arm can be paired with aftermarket steering components (e.g., heavier-duty tie rods, adjustable steering columns) if you plan to modify your truck s steering system. This flexibility allows for customization without sacrificing compatibility.

#### **Cons**

1. **Age-Related Wear and Potential Issues**

Even if the gearbox and pitman arm are new or refurbished, they may still exhibit wear or fail prematurely if the rest of the steering system (e.g., tie rods, bushings, idler arm) is neglected. Over time, these components can wear out, leading to additional repairs.

2. **Limited Modernization Options**

The 7818191 gearbox is a mechanical unit, not an electric power steering (EPS) system. If you re considering modernizing your C10 s steering system for better precision or reduced effort, this part may not integrate seamlessly with newer technologies. However, for most classic truck owners, mechanical power steering remains sufficient.

3. **Potential for Counterfeit or Low-Quality Parts**

When purchasing used or aftermarket parts, there is a risk of receiving counterfeit or poorly manufactured components. Always buy from reputable sellers (e.g., RockAuto, Summit Racing, or salvage yards with a good reputation) and inspect the part for quality upon arrival. A genuine GM part or a well-known brand (e.g., Moroso, Stewart-Warner) is less likely to fail.

4. **Installation Challenges**

While the installation is generally straightforward, some users may encounter difficulties if they lack experience with Chevy C10 steering systems. Issues like misaligned mounting points, stiff bolts, or damaged mounting surfaces can complicate the process. If unsure, consulting a mechanic or watching detailed installation videos can help.

5. **Maintenance Requirements**

Power steering gearboxes require periodic maintenance, such as checking fluid levels, flushing the system, and inspecting for leaks. Neglecting these tasks can lead to premature failure of the gearbox or related components. The pitman arm may also require lubrication or replacement if it becomes loose or corroded.

6. **Limited Customization for Off-Road Use**

The 7818191 gearbox is designed for on-road use in a 2WD C10. If you plan to use your truck heavily off-road or in extreme conditions, the standard gearbox may not be robust enough. In such cases, upgrading to a heavier-duty or off-road-specific steering system (e.g., from companies like Moroso or Stewart-Warner) may be necessary.

7. **Potential for Hidden Damage**

If purchasing a used gearbox or pitman arm, there may be hidden damage (e.g., cracked housing, worn internal gears, or bent shafts) that isn t immediately visible. Always inspect the part thoroughly or request a warranty from the seller to mitigate this risk.
